Can a block of cheap toilet paper be drained?
You wouldn't think it would, but toilet paper can block a drain. The quality of toilet paper, toilet flow, and overuse can all contribute to blocked drains. Cheap toilet paper may not break down enough in the water before being flushed down the pipes. Farvardin 13, 1398 AP

Does tissue paper block drains?
Facial tissues and paper towels have a different design than toilet paper. These paper products are not made to break down like toilet paper, so they can end up clogging your pipes or drain. If this happens, it can cause a serious blockage that causes sewage to back up into your home.
Can I use Kleenex instead of toilet paper?
The simple answer: No, Kleenex should not be put in toilets. Toilet paper is specifically designed to break down in toilets, so it won't clog your home's plumbing. As a result, Kleenex can get stuck in bends or other debris in the pipes, causing a stoppage in your plumbing system. Farvardin 29, 1399 AP

Why can't fabrics be washed?
No, you can not. Unlike toilet paper, things like tissues and tea towels are designed to retain their strength as much as possible, especially when wet. Throw a tissue or paper towel down the toilet and it won't break, at least not easily, making it an ideal candidate for clogging pipes. Farvardin 5, 1399 AP

Which cultures do not use toilet paper?
France, Portugal, Italy, Japan, Argentina, Venezuela and Spain: Instead of toilet paper, people in these countries (most of them from Europe) usually have a bidet in their toilets. A bidet like a toilet, but also includes a spout that shoots water like a water fountain to rinse you. Azar 10, 1399 AP
